How did the Halifax explosion effect Canada?

this explosion impacted Canada because there was so much damages that Canada had to pay for, even though it was only $35 million in their time, it would be $500 million in 2007 dollars. Since there was so much damages and so much injuries and lives lost is how it effected Canada. xXx The Halifax Explosion of 1917 had an imapct on Canada because the ship originally caught flame before exploding. A crowd gathered to watch the ship burn, causing much more casualties. The total people killed instantly (when the ship did explode after drifting into port) was 1,900, and left 9,000 injured. Almost all of the North end of Halifax was destroyed, Mont-Blanc (the ship that exploded) shattered into little pieces and were blasted 2 miles in every diredction, houses windows shattered 50 miles away. The Halifax Explosion caused so much damage and killed so many that Canada released Relief Efforts, and money poured in as far as China. Canada gave 18 million and slowly, Halifax was pieced back together.
